We are delighted to offer a selection of large 2-year-old potted Irish heritage apple trees, perfect for adding a piece of Ireland’s rich food crop heritage to your garden. These robust and healthy trees are ready to be planted and will soon yield delicious, unique apples. Pay a visit to our 20 acre organic farm in Scariff, Co. Clare and explore the varieties on offer including:

  • Ard Carin Russet: Golden russeted fruit, ripe in September.
  • April Queen: A large juicy apple useful both for cooking and juicing.
  • Belvedere House: Deep crimson fruit with crimson coloured flesh. Excellent for jams, jellies and tarts.
  • Bloody Butcher: Large red and yellow apple. Eaten fresh from the tree, it has a mild flavour.
  • Councillor: An attractive apple which is used for cooking in early September, before sweetening to become tasty and aromatic as an eating apple.
  • Eight Square: A tasty bite-sized green eating apple, a children’s favourite.
  • Sweet William: A medium sized, round apple with creamy yellow skin, red stripes and stippling. The flesh is crisp, very white and very sweet.
